The IC or internal combustion forklifts are used most frequently for indoor operations such as manufacturing, trucking, bottling and warehousing. Typically, these units use solid rubber tires referred to as cushion tires. The Internal Combustion forklift models could operate either by dual fuel, diesel or LPG or Liquid Petroleum Gas. The dual fuel units function with both LPG and gasoline. These machines can run on either fuel but not at the same time. Internal Combustion or IC engines are Class 4 forklifts. The engine can power the truck, the hydraulics and all functions of the truck.
The GO4 Series and the Nissan Forklift Platinum II units have capacities ranging from 3000 to 11,000 pounds. These units offer CARB certified dual-fuel or LPG/gasoline or LPG engines. The CARB certification on these particular engines gives them the confidence to help protect the environment because it allows the forklifts to produce low emissions. The environmental certifications like CARB, help employers offer cleaner and therefore safer working environments for their employees.
The fuel management systems provided by Nissan, the LP/Gas combinations, offer optimum engine operation to decrease exhaust emissions and provide fantastic fuel economy at the same time. Each Platinum II fork truck is standard equipped with their compressive engine protection system in place to be able to warn operators in the event of excessive heat or a severe drop in oil pressure. This specific system helps to extend your drive train and engine life to help keep your lift truck investment working at its optimum ability.
